Responsibilities:
- Assist the lead teacher in planning and implementing age-appropriate lesson plans and activities
- Provide a safe and nurturing environment for children in the classroom
- Assist with classroom management and behavior guidance
- Support children's social, emotional, and cognitive development
- Engage children in educational and play-based activities
- Assist with daily tasks such as mealtime, naptime, and diaper changes
- Collaborate with other staff members to ensure a positive learning environment
Qualifications:
- Previous experience working with children in a daycare or educational setting
- Knowledge of childhood development and early childhood education principles
- Strong communication and interpersonal skills
- Ability to work effectively as part of a team
- Patience, flexibility, and a genuine love for working with children
- Basic understanding of literacy education and math concepts in early childhood
Note: This position may require lifting or carrying children, as well as standing or sitting for extended periods of time.
